How to Reset Your Password on iPhone If You Forgot It
Forgetting Your iPhone Password
Forgetting your iPhone password can be a frustrating experience, but there are steps you can take to reset it and regain access to your device. Here's what you can do:
1. Use iCloud to Reset Your Password
If you have enabled Find My iPhone on your device, you can use iCloud to remotely reset your password. Simply go to iCloud.com and follow the instructions to reset your password.
2. Use Recovery Mode
If you haven't set up Find My iPhone or if the iCloud method doesn't work, you can use recovery mode to reset your password. Connect your iPhone to your computer, open iTunes, and select the option to restore your device. This will erase all data on your iPhone, including the password.
3. Contact Apple Support
If the above methods don't work or if you're still having trouble resetting your password, you can contact Apple Support for assistance. They may be able to help you regain access to your device.
Remember to Set a Secure Password
Once you have reset your password and regained access to your iPhone, make sure to set a secure password that you can remember. Consider using a password manager to securely store and manage your passwords to avoid this situation in the future.
